Some of the changes for the 2008 season include:
Resurfacing of the Hard Courts. All four hard
courts will be resurfaced in mid-April (actual dates will
depend on the weather). A Chatham company, All-Lined-Up, has
been selected for the project and they will apply an acrylic
surface with silica sand texture. The colour scheme will be
the same as many ATP hard court venues, consisting of blue
courts surrounded by light green. This combination is said
to increase ball visibility, especially during evening play.
